Understanding B.Tech in AI and ML
A B.Tech in Artificial Intelligence and Machine Learning is a complete four-year degree course at the undergraduate level. The program aims to educate students on the latest innovations, such as deep learning and neural networks. AICTE-approved, this syllabus transcends the coding of the past.
The ultimate aim is to develop software that can use sample data or prior experience to find solutions to complex real-world problems on its own. Such a program can technically be about anything within the vast range of automation possibilities, from analysing financial data to predicting customer behaviour and optimising robotic movements for resource saving.

2. Premium Salary Packages
Artificial intelligence and machine learning specialists are among the highest-paid roles in the tech industry. In 2026, a recent engineering graduate from the best engineering colleges in Gurugram may expect starting salaries that are significantly higher than those in conventional software roles.
| Job Role | Average Entry-Level Salary (LPA) | Mid-Level Salary (3-5 Years) |
| AI Engineer | ₹8.5 – ₹12 LPA | ₹20 – ₹35 LPA |
| Machine Learning Engineer | ₹7.5 – ₹11 LPA | ₹18 – ₹30 LPA |
| Data Scientist | ₹8.0 – ₹13 LPA | ₹22 – ₹40 LPA |
| Generative AI Specialist | ₹10.0 – ₹15 LPA | ₹25 – ₹50+ LPA |
